The Patriot Pioneers waltzed into their match on Wednesday with six straight wins but they left with seven. They came out on top in a nail-biter against Hayfield and snuck past 50-48. For Patriot, this counts as revenge for the 52-41 defeat the Hawks walked away with the last time they faced one another back in March of 2023.
When it comes to explaining why Hayfield lost, one person who can't be blamed is Parker Cage. Despite the final result, he scored 12 points along with seven rebounds and two steals. The team also got some help courtesy of Andy Ramirez, who scored nine points.
Patriot's victory was their 12th straight at home dating back to last season, which pushed their record up to 16-4. As for Hayfield, their loss ended a five-game streak of away wins and brought them to 13-6.
